July 27, 2021Nuthut is Opening on 5th Ave. in Bay Ridge

The Nuthut is coming to 6920 – 5th Avenue. The NutHut sells roasted nuts and coffee.

Before this was the Nuthut, it was Hayatt Pharmacy (it’s next to Elegante Pizzaria)

July 27, 202188 Year Old Woman Robbed at Gunpoint – 84th & 17th Avenue (Updated)
Around 2:00 pm on Tuesday afternoon an 88-year-old woman was robbed by two armed suspects outside of 8430 – 17th Avenue. More info here

July 27, 2021Patty’s Meat Market on 7th Avenue Closed

Eddie, the butcher closed Patty’s Meat Marker at 7917 – 7th Avenue. People are sad about the store closing because it was open for many years and now they need a new butcher.

July 26, 2021Covid Vaccine at Ft. Hamilton HS on 7/27

Fort Hamilton High School will have the Covid Vaccine on Tuesday, July 27th from 9:00 am – 4:00 pm.
Entrance is 85th Street and Narrows in the boys’ gym.
The vaccination site is open to the community, so please share with anyone interested in the covid vaccine.
Anyone under 18 years must have a parent or guardian with them (ages 12-15) or consent from parent or guardian (ages 16-17).
